Futur Proche (Near Future) Tense Conjugation of the French Verb dégoter
Introduction to the verb dégoter
The English translation of the French verb dégoter is “to find/get hold of”. It is pronounced as “dey-GO-tey”.

Example 1: Je vais dégoter un cadeau pour mon ami demain. (I am going to find/get hold of a gift for my friend tomorrow.)
Example 2: Nous allons dégoter un nouvel appartement le mois prochain. (We are going to find/get hold of a new apartment next month.)
Example 3: Tu vas dégoter des informations sur le projet cette semaine. (You are going to find/get hold of information about the project this week.)
Table of the Futur Proche (Near Future) Tense Conjugation of dégoter
Pronoun | Conjugation | Short Example | English Translation |
---|---|---|---|
je | vais dégoter | Je vais dégoter un cadeau. | I am going to find a gift. |
tu | vas dégoter | Tu vas dégoter un emploi. | You are going to find a job. |
il | va dégoter | Il va dégoter une solution. | He is going to find a solution. |
elle | va dégoter | Elle va dégoter un appartement. | She is going to find an apartment. |
on | va dégoter | On va dégoter un restaurant. | We/One are going to find a restaurant. |
nous | allons dégoter | Nous allons dégoter des billets. | We are going to find tickets. |
vous | allez dégoter | Vous allez dégoter un accord. | You are going to find an agreement. |
ils | vont dégoter | Ils vont dégoter un nouveau produit. | They are going to find a new product. |
elles | vont dégoter | Elles vont dégoter des vêtements. | They are going to find some clothes. |
